    Description

      Scenario:
      ---------

      Validating dual stack Ipv4 and IPv6 address assignment to Neutron VM by creating the IPV6 subnet first, then spawn the VM and then creating IPV4 subnet.

      1.create a IPV6 subnet in slaac mode:

      neutron net-create mynet1
      neutron subnet-create mynet1 2001:db8:1234::/64 --name ipv6s1 --ip-version 6 --ipv6-ra-mode slaac --ipv6-address-mode slaac
      neutron router-create router1
      neutron router-interface-add router1 ipv6s1

      2.spawn the VM:

      nova boot --flavor m1.small --image cirros-0.3.4-x86_64-uec --availability-zone nova:test-ovs --nic net-name=mynet1 vm1

      3.create IPV4 subnet to the same network (also enable dhcp on ODL):

      neutron subnet-create mynet1 13.0.0.0/24 --name ipv4s1 --enable-dhcp

      5.reboot the VM

      ------------------------------

      VM doesn't receive dhcp offer even if we run dhcp client or reboot the VM. Also, the table 60 entry is missing.

      But, if we create another VM, then both the addresses are assigned for it. The corresponding table 60 entries are also seen.
